Prevent Water Damages
To stop water damage to your home, on a regular basis cleaning your seamless gutters and downspouts is crucial. Clogged rain gutters can cause water to overflow, leading to leaks and architectural damages. Inspect your gutters a minimum of twice a year, especially prior to the rainy period. Get rid of leaves, twigs, and debris, guaranteeing water moves easily. Don't forget to evaluate downspouts; they ought to direct water far from your structure. If you observe any blockages, make use of a plumbing professional's serpent or a pipe to remove them. Think about mounting rain gutter guards to minimize particles accumulation in the future. By maintaining your gutters and downspouts in top form, you're securing your home from potential water damages and costly fixings down the line. Your roof covering and foundation will thanks!

Trim Overhanging Tree Branches
When you have overhanging tree branches near your roof covering, it's vital to cut them back to avoid potential damage. These branches can scratch versus your roofing products during gusty weather condition, leading to wear and tear with time. Additionally, dropping branches during storms can cause significant injury, not just to your roofing system yet likewise to your rain gutters and home siding.
Consistently inspect the trees around your home and try to find branches that hang too near to your roofline. It's finest to cut them back at the very least a few feet away to ensure they won't present a threat. Take into consideration hiring an expert tree service. if you're not comfortable doing this yourself.
Check for Damaged or Missing Tiles
To preserve the integrity of your roofing, routinely check for damaged or missing out on tiles, as these problems can cause leaks and additional wear and tear. Beginning by examining your roofing from the ground utilizing field glasses, seeking curled, broken, or smashed tiles. If you notice any kind of missing out on items, do something about it instantly to stop water from seeping beneath.
When you're up close, really feel free to stroll along your roofing (if it's risk-free) to get a better appearance. Take note of the sides and ridges, as these locations are much more at risk to damage. Change the damaged shingles as soon as possible. if you find any type of problems.

Make Certain Proper Attic Air Flow
Just how can correct attic ventilation effect your roofing's long life? Too much address warm can damage roof covering materials, while trapped dampness can result in mold development and wood rot.
To guarantee correct ventilation, check that your attic room has both intake and exhaust vents. This enables a continual flow of air, helping to maintain temperature levels stable. Installing soffit vents and ridge vents can advertise this air flow properly.
In addition, check your insulation; it ought to never ever obstruct vents. A well-ventilated attic room not only lengthens the life of your roofing but additionally enhances power efficiency in your house. Just how Typically Should I Tidy My Rain Gutters?
You need to cleanse your seamless gutters at the very least two times a year, preferably in spring and autumn. This prevents blockages, water damage, and assurances proper water drainage. Normal maintenance maintains your roof and home secure from potential concerns.
